Limitless Talent with Claire Chandler
94% of companies know their A-players. Only 6% have a plan to keep them. 🚨 That’s a problem!
In this episode, Claire breaks down why employees today are subscribers—deciding daily whether to "renew" with your company. She shares the one-page succession plan every leader needs, the secret to career paths that retain top talent, and why most businesses are failing at succession planning (but don’t have to!).

Rosie in My Pocket: Resentment
Resentment—it’s sneaky, it’s cringy, and it loves to keep us stuck. But here’s the hard truth: it’s not about them... it’s about us!
That nagging “Why do they get to do that, but I don’t?” feeling? It’s a signal that we haven’t set boundaries or spoken up for what we need.
In this episode, Rosie is unpacking the real root of resentment: unspoken boundaries and unmet needs. By shifting the focus inward, we gain the power to course correct, communicate clearly, and release the weight of resentment.

The Future of Leadership is Female with Don Barden
In this powerful episode,The Future of Leadership is Female, Rosie sits down with Don Barden, a classically trained economist and global business expert, to unpack groundbreaking research on leadership.
Drawing from his three-year global study, Don shares data-driven insights from his new book, Here Come the Girls, revealing that female-led organizations outperform their male-led counterparts 3 to 1 in revenue, profitability, and employee retention.
This episode isn't about gender but truth and effective leadership. Don dives deep into the critical problem-solving strategies that set high-performing leaders apart, offering three actionable steps anyone can apply to lead better.

Rosie in My Pocket: Not Masking Anger
Anger—it’s powerful, it’s fiery, and sometimes... It’s not really anger at all. Often, it’s just a cover for deeper emotions like fear, grief, or loneliness. And let’s be real—it’s way easier to say “I’m mad” than to admit “I’m hurt.”
In this episode, Rosie is peeling back the layers of anger and learning how to name what we really feel. Because when we do, we connect better—with ourselves and with others. So, here’s your challenge: the next time you or someone else seems angry, pause and ask—what’s really going on? 💡✨
